• I have been having this issue for several weeks and cannot fix it.

    When I go to put a photo in a post (through the normal photo importer in the normal post editor), the photo seems to import fine. When the photo has uploaded, I get a broken image. I can click to edit the image and see my image there. The thumbnail appears broken as well. When I publish the post, the image still appears broken. I recently published a test to see what my readers see.

    http://rediscoveringdomesticity.com/2011/02/20/this-is-just-a-test/

    So far, I have:

    * disabled all plugins
    * reverted to twenty ten theme
    * deleted plugins that were new since the problem started
    * upgraded my browser

    I am currently adding images by hosting in photobucket and using html. I want to keep my site loading quickly, so I would love to be able to just load images again.

    Any ideas?

    Okay, so if you’re using TwentyTen, and you upload an image while using TwentyTen, then the image is broken?

    If so, then the issue isn’t with your Theme. Check your media settings, to make sure your upload path (and also, file permissions) are all correct.
